2. Cheerio简介 Cheerio是一个类似于jQuery的库,用于在Node.js中解析和操作HTML文档。由于其简单易用,Cheerio在网络爬虫领域非常受欢迎。以下是使用Cheerio进行网络爬虫的一些示例: 示例一:单页面抓取 我们使用Cheerio来抓取网页的标题和内容。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 constcheerio=r
在这篇文章中,我将介绍目前比较流行的20款网络爬虫工具供你参考。希望你能找到最适合你需求的工具。 1. 八爪鱼 八爪鱼是一款免费且功能强大的网站爬虫,用于从网站上提取你需要的几乎所有类型的数据。你可以使用八爪鱼来采集市面上几乎所有的网站。八爪鱼提供两种采集模式 - 简易模式和自定义采集模式,非程序员可以快...
▲ Crawler与Encog Crawler专注网站结构抓取,Encog为高级机器学习框架,支持多种神经网络与HTTP爬虫。▲ Crawljax Crawljax 专注于Ajax应用测试,通过事件触发与数据填充实现自动化测试。综上所述,这些开源项目为开发者提供了丰富的爬虫和机器学习工具,助力他们高效完成各类任务。
我和很多学python的同学聊过,至少有30%以上的人学Python是为了网络爬虫,也就是采集网站的数据,不得不说这确实是一个刚性需求。 但一个残酷的事实是,即使一部分人学了Python,掌握了requests、urllib、bs4等爬虫技术,也无法有效地获取标的网站的数据。 因为无论是淘宝、京东、亚马逊、Ebay这样的购物网站,还是小红书、...
1️⃣ OpenSearchServer:这款免费爬虫在互联网上享有高评级,提供一站式解决方案,支持多种搜索功能,适合构建自定义索引策略。2️⃣ Spinn3r:从博客、新闻、社交网站等提取内容,提供闪电般快速的API,支持高级垃圾邮件保护,确保数据安全。3️⃣ Import.io:几分钟内抓取数百万网页,无需编程即可构建API,自动...
Scrapy是一个非常强大的爬虫框架,支持异步爬取,可以处理复杂的网页结构。BeautifulSoup则以其简洁的API和强大的HTML解析能力著称,适合处理HTML文档。Requests库则以其简单易用的特点受到广泛欢迎,适合进行HTTP请求。除了Python,还有其他语言的爬虫工具也很出色。例如,Java语言的Jsoup工具,以其强大的HTML解析...
2024年最热门的11个开源网络爬虫和抓取工具 1. Crawlee. 语言:Node.js, Python | GitHub: 15.4K+ 星 |链接 Crawlee 是一个完整的网络抓取和浏览器自动化库,旨在快速高效地构建可靠的爬虫。内置的反封锁功能可以让您的机器人看起来像真实的人类用户,降低被封的可能性。降低被封的可能性。
HTTrack是一款开源且免费的网络爬虫,专为网站复制而设计。它允许用户将整个互联网网站轻松下载到个人计算机上,为用户提供对文件夹中所有文件的全面访问,包括照片等多媒体内容。此外,HTTrack还支持Proxy功能,进一步提升爬行速度。3. 解析中心 对于网络爬行的需求,ParseHub无疑是一个出色的选择。这款网络爬虫软件专为...
1.Scrapy Scrapy是一个强大的Python爬虫框架,它提供了全面而灵活的工具,可用于快速、高效地构建爬虫。Scrapy具有良好的可扩展性,可实现分布式爬虫、数据存储、页面解析等功能。同时,Scrapy还支持异步处理请求,大大提高了爬虫效率。 2.BeautifulSoup BeautifulSoup是一个用于解析HTML和XML的Python库,它能够帮助用户从网页中...